Rescue: An Important Concept of the Bible?

In the Bible, Rescue plays a central role as a symbol of God’s unwavering commitment to save and protect His people. It appears in numerous stories, such as Noah being saved from the flood, the Israelites’ deliverance from Egypt, and Jesus rescuing humanity from sin through His sacrifice. These narratives highlight themes of divine intervention, hope, and redemption. Rescue serves to illustrate God’s power, mercy, and faithfulness, reassuring believers that no matter the challenges they face, God is there to guide and save them. It fosters trust and strengthens the relationship between God and His followers.
Rescue: The Best Bible Verses
1. When thou passest through the waters, I will be with thee; and through the rivers, they shall not overflow thee: when thou walkest through the fire, thou shalt not be burned; neither shall the flame kindle upon thee. — [Isaiah 43:2]
2. The LORD thy God in the midst of thee is mighty; he will save, he will rejoice over thee with joy; he will rest in his love, he will joy over thee with singing. — [Zephaniah 3:17]
3. And even to your old age I am he; and even to hoar hairs will I carry you: I have made, and I will bear; even I will carry, and will deliver you. — [Isaiah 46:4]
4. I sought the LORD, and he heard me, and delivered me from all my fears. — [Psalms 34:4]
5. And call upon me in the day of trouble: I will deliver thee, and thou shalt glorify me. — [Psalms 50:15]
6. Be not afraid of their faces: for I am with thee to deliver thee, saith the LORD. — [Jeremiah 1:8]
7. The righteous cry, and the LORD heareth, and delivereth them out of all their troubles. — [Psalms 34:17]
8. Surely he shall deliver thee from the snare of the fowler, and from the noisome pestilence. — [Psalms 91:3]
9. Because he hath set his love upon me, therefore will I deliver him: I will set him on high, because he hath known my name. He shall call upon me, and I will answer him: I will be with him in trouble; I will deliver him, and honour him. — [Psalms 91:14-15]
10. Say to them that are of a fearful heart, Be strong, fear not: behold, your God will come with vengeance, even God with a recompence; he will come and save you. — [Isaiah 35:4]
11. Be pleased, O LORD, to deliver me: O LORD, make haste to help me. — [Psalms 40:13]
12. Who hath delivered us from the power of darkness, and hath translated us into the kingdom of his dear Son: — [Colossians 1:13]
13. I called upon the LORD in distress: the LORD answered me, and set me in a large place. — [Psalms 118:5]
14. And the Lord shall deliver me from every evil work, and will preserve me unto his heavenly kingdom: to whom be glory for ever and ever. Amen. — [2 Timothy 4:18]
15. The Lord knoweth how to deliver the godly out of temptations, and to reserve the unjust unto the day of judgment to be punished: — [2 Peter 2:9]
16. He brought me forth also into a large place; he delivered me, because he delighted in me. — [Psalms 18:19]
17. Who delivered us from so great a death, and doth deliver: in whom we trust that he will yet deliver us; — [2 Corinthians 1:10]
18. O wretched man that I am! who shall deliver me from the body of this death? I thank God through Jesus Christ our Lord. So then with the mind I myself serve the law of God; but with the flesh the law of sin. — [Romans 7:24-25]
19. Our fathers trusted in thee: they trusted, and thou didst deliver them. They cried unto thee, and were delivered: they trusted in thee, and were not confounded. — [Psalms 22:4-5]
20. Then they cried unto the LORD in their trouble, and he delivered them out of their distresses. — [Psalms 107:6]
21. As for me, I will call upon God; and the LORD shall save me. — [Psalms 55:16]
22. Bow down thine ear to me; deliver me speedily: be thou my strong rock, for an house of defence to save me. — [Psalms 31:2]
23. For he shall deliver the needy when he crieth; the poor also, and him that hath no helper. — [Psalms 72:12]
24. O keep my soul, and deliver me: let me not be ashamed; for I put my trust in thee. — [Psalms 25:20]
25. And the LORD shall help them, and deliver them: he shall deliver them from the wicked, and save them, because they trust in him. — [Psalms 37:40]
26. For he hath delivered me out of all trouble: and mine eye hath seen his desire upon mine enemies. — [Psalms 54:7]
27. He brought me forth also into a large place: he delivered me, because he delighted in me. — [2 Samuel 22:20]
28. Send thine hand from above; rid me, and deliver me out of great waters, from the hand of strange children; — [Psalms 144:7]
29. Deliver me in thy righteousness, and cause me to escape: incline thine ear unto me, and save me. — [Psalms 71:2]
30. Draw nigh unto my soul, and redeem it: deliver me because of mine enemies. — [Psalms 69:18]
